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79281 1193421524 1906954 44 48464
628977929 67360850880
628977929 67360850880
04711008699 848657875 4293795
All about undefined
Interested in learning more?
628977929 67360850880
04711008699 848657875 4293795
See more
34503849 3701
511 839267171 3585
See more
3669360758 808
38272356368 344092 65289 9956
See more